LOS ANGELES(AP) - A group of Hispanic activist is promising to "punish" Governor Schwarzenegger for his veto of legislation that would have let illegal immigrants get drivers licenses.
Leaders of Latino Movement USA held a rally today in Los Angeles. The group is soliciting the donation of movies the former actor starred in for a symbolic destruction in December.
Last month, Schwarzenegger vetoed a bill that would have let up to two million immigrants drive legally.
The legislation's supporters have vowed to go after the governor, whom they think caved in to public sentiment.
Schwarzenegger has said the bill ignored his requirement of key security safeguards -- an identifying mark that would differentiate them from licenses held by US citizens and legal residents.
